When trying out Bruichladdich, you have to remember it’s roots. Heck, you gotta remember your roots when reviewing too.

So tit for tat: Bruichladdich went through a silent period after pumping out tons of whisky with questionable quality of casks. Once they re-opened, they went about re-casking various barrels in order to revitalize what they could while the workers were getting busy filling proper quality casks.
